The Rise and Transformation of Music Distribution: A Historical Perspective
From the initial beginnings of sheet music to the digital age's massive online platforms, the method we consume and distribute music has undergone a dramatic evolution. In the past, tangible formats such as vinyl records, cassette tapes, and CDs ruled the industry. Distribution trusted on brick-and-mortar stores and record labels, creating a centralized system.
- However, with the advent of the internet, music distribution has been revolutionized forever.
- Digital downloads and streaming services have emerged as dominant forces, offering unprecedented convenience to consumers.
- Independent artists can now sidestep traditional gatekeepers and connect with their audiences immediately.
Contemporary landscape presents both opportunities and dilemmas for the music industry. Determining a sustainable model for revenue generation in a digital age remains a significant task.
